Vishay Intertechnology has been grinding through a tough downcycle, as weak demand across auto and industrial markets has weighed heavily on volumes and margins. Despite current weak end-markets and ongoing destocking challenges, not to mention limited near-term visibility, management is investing heavily in capacity to capitalize on future demand. There is a risk that weak end-market conditions persist through 2025, but the "electrify everything" trend remains in place and should drive a strong upcycle at some point.
